The story is terrific, the music delightful, and the DVD extras are fun, from deleted scenes to fun behind-the-scenes segments for animation geeks like me. Especially the “Making of a Princess” feature with insight from the animation master (and Princess and Frog exec producer) John Lasseter himself.
